Delane
Girl NameDelane: a female name of Latin origin meaning "The name comes from the Old French “de la noye > de lannoy,” which in turn comes from the Latin “alnus > alnetum,” which means “a place where alders grow, a grove of alders". It derives from the Latin word "alnus > alnetum > de La Noye > De Lannoy".
